2017-A250 (ACTIVE) - Summary

Provides for driver safety related use restrictions on drivers' licenses and permits including operation of a motor vehicle within a limited mileage radius, after sunset, and on limited access highways.

 AN ACT to amend the vehicle and traffic law, in relation to restrictions
   for driver safety on drivers' license or permits
 
   THE PEOPLE OF THE STATE OF NEW YORK, REPRESENTED IN SENATE AND  ASSEM-
 BLY, DO ENACT AS FOLLOWS:

   Section  1. Paragraph (c) of subdivision 2 of section 501 of the vehi-
 cle and traffic law is amended by adding three new  subparagraphs  (iv),
 (v) and (vi) to read as follows:
   (IV) A RESTRICTION LIMITING THE OPERATION OF A MOTOR VEHICLE TO WITHIN
 A  LIMITED  MILEAGE  RADIUS,  IMPOSED  PURSUANT  TO SUBDIVISION THREE OF
 SECTION FIVE HUNDRED SIX OF THIS ARTICLE.
   (V) A RESTRICTION PROHIBITING THE OPERATION OF A MOTOR  VEHICLE  AFTER
 SUNSET,  IMPOSED  PURSUANT  TO SUBDIVISION THREE OF SECTION FIVE HUNDRED
 SIX OF THIS ARTICLE.
   (VI) A RESTRICTION PROHIBITING THE OPERATION OF  A  MOTOR  VEHICLE  ON
 LIMITED  ACCESS  HIGHWAYS,  IMPOSED  PURSUANT  TO  SUBDIVISION  THREE OF
 SECTION FIVE HUNDRED SIX OF THIS ARTICLE.
   § 2. Subdivision 3 of section 506 of the vehicle and traffic  law,  as
 added by chapter 780 of the laws of 1972, is amended to read as follows:
   3.  If  the  licensee  satisfactorily  passes any such examination, he
 shall be so informed and his license shall continue to be valid.  If  he
 fails to pass, the commissioner shall take such reasonable action as may
 be  required.    Such action may consist of imposing restrictions on the
 use of the license of such person INCLUDING, BUT  NOT  LIMITED  TO,  THE
 RESTRICTIONS  SET  FORTH IN SUBPARAGRAPHS (IV), (V) AND/OR (VI) OF PARA-
 GRAPH (C) OF SUBDIVISION  TWO  OF  SECTION  FIVE  HUNDRED  ONE  OF  THIS
 ARTICLE, in suspending such license for a definite or indefinite period,
 or  in  revoking such license. If any such person fails after reasonable
 notice or refuses to submit to  an  examination,  the  commissioner  may
